Increased Cybersecurity Concerns
As the adoption of AI technologies in the financial sector grows, so do concerns regarding cybersecurity. The ai in-fintech market is likely to respond to these challenges by developing advanced security solutions powered by AI. Financial institutions are increasingly aware of the potential risks associated with cyber threats, prompting them to invest in AI-driven cybersecurity measures. Reports indicate that cyberattacks on financial institutions in the GCC have risen by over 30% in recent years. This heightened awareness may drive demand for AI solutions that enhance security protocols, thereby fostering growth in the ai in-fintech market.
Regulatory Support for Innovation
The regulatory landscape in the GCC appears to be increasingly supportive of innovation within the ai in-fintech market. Governments are actively promoting the adoption of advanced technologies, including artificial intelligence, to enhance financial services. For instance, the Central Bank of the UAE has introduced initiatives aimed at fostering fintech innovation, which could lead to a more robust ecosystem. This regulatory backing may encourage startups and established financial institutions to invest in AI solutions, potentially increasing market growth. As a result, the ai in-fintech market could witness a surge in new products and services, enhancing competition and consumer choice.
Investment in Digital Infrastructure
The GCC region is witnessing substantial investment in digital infrastructure, which is likely to bolster the ai in-fintech market. Governments and private entities are channeling resources into enhancing connectivity and digital platforms, facilitating the integration of AI technologies in financial services. For example, the UAE's Vision 2021 aims to create a world-class digital economy, which could provide a conducive environment for AI adoption. This investment may lead to improved access to financial services, particularly for underserved populations, thereby expanding the market's reach and potential customer base.
Rising Demand for Personalized Financial Services
Consumer expectations in the GCC are evolving, with a growing demand for personalized financial services. The ai in-fintech market is well-positioned to address this need through the use of AI-driven analytics and customer insights. Financial institutions are leveraging AI to analyze customer data, enabling them to offer tailored products and services. According to recent studies, approximately 70% of consumers in the region express a preference for personalized financial solutions. This trend suggests that the ai in-fintech market could experience significant growth as companies strive to meet these expectations, ultimately enhancing customer satisfaction and loyalty.
Collaboration Between Fintechs and Traditional Banks
The collaboration between fintech companies and traditional banks in the GCC is emerging as a key driver for the ai in-fintech market. These partnerships enable banks to leverage innovative AI solutions developed by fintechs, enhancing their service offerings. Such collaborations can lead to the development of new products that combine the agility of fintechs with the stability of established banks. This trend is likely to accelerate as both sectors recognize the mutual benefits of working together, potentially leading to a more dynamic and competitive ai in-fintech market.
